Strategies and Technologies in Maxillofacial Surgery
Maxillofacial surgery integrates various advanced techniques and innovations to attain optimum outcomes in facial restoration. These improvements have changed the field, enabling dental cosmetic surgeons to offer more precise and efficient treatments.
One such strategy is computer-assisted surgery, which includes the use of computer-generated versions and pictures to plan and overview surgeries. This modern technology allows cosmetic surgeons to envision the client's makeup in 3 measurements, improving precision and reducing the danger of difficulties.
Furthermore, the advent of online medical planning has further enhanced end results. This method entails the creation of a digital surgical strategy based upon the client's unique composition, permitting doctors to simulate and fine-tune the procedure prior to running.
Furthermore, progressed imaging modern technologies, such as CT scans and 3D modeling, give detailed information concerning the patient's facial structure, helping in the preparation and implementation of complex surgeries.
These strategies and innovations have transformed maxillofacial surgery, making it possible for oral doctors to accomplish remarkable lead to face repair.
Bring Back Functionality and Aesthetics Via Facial Repair
To restore performance and looks through facial restoration, you can count on sophisticated methods and innovations in maxillofacial surgery. Right here are four ways oral specialists complete this:
1. Bone grafting: By using bone from your very own body or synthetic products, doctors can rebuild and bring back missing out on or damaged bone structure in the face, enhancing both performance and looks.
2. Oral implants: Missing out on teeth can be changed with dental implants, which not just recover your capability to chew and talk appropriately yet likewise enhance the look of your smile.
3. Soft cells fixing: In cases where facial injury has triggered damage to soft cells, cosmetic surgeons can repair and reconstruct these tissues to bring back regular function and visual appeals.
4. Facial prosthetics: In more intricate cases, personalized facial prosthetics can be utilized to change missing out on or harmed facial functions, restoring both capability and appearance.
